Unique Metal Sculpture by Graham Hawkins
“Steelquirks” describes Graham’s work perfectly; hand-crafted in steel with a quirky twist in construction, form or theme.
Graham spent much of his youth around art and more specifically sculpture, helping his Father who worked at Bath Academy of Art.
After a career in IT, he returned to art as a purely personal pastime, creating metal sculptures using skills learned over 30 years ago. As the sculptures filled his home and garden he was encouraged to share his work with a wider audience.
Having had no formal art education beyond A level, Graham feels no restrictions as to what or how he should make things and does not feel the need to pursue a single direction.
When asked what inspires him, Graham’s usual reply is “anything and everything”. He’s even been known to pause the TV to take a photo of something which catches his eye and sparks his imagination.
